
Track and Field Wraps Up Day One at the Black & Gold Invitational
March 23, 2018 | Track & Field
NASHVILLE, Tenn. -- The University of Louisville track and field teams wrapped up the first day of competition at the Vanderbilt Black & Gold Invitational with three top eight performances.Â

Freshman Lucas Weaver led the Cards with a third place finish in the men's pole vault with an outdoor season best jump of 4.60m/15'1". Weaver also ran the 200 meter dash with a personal best time of 23.86 for 24th place.Â

Teammate Albert Kosgei snagged a season best as well finishing 14th in the 1500 meter run with a time of 3:57.04.Â

Mia Ross and Aurilla Wilson rounded out day one for the Cardinals in the 1500 meter run. Ross finished sixth with a time of 4:33.26 while Wilson recorded a personal best time of 4:35.08 for 8th place.Â

The Cards will wrap up competition at the Black & Gold Invitational on Saturday afternoon.
